Significant Single-Player Experiences
Single-player titles have the remarkable capacity to immerse gamers in compelling stories that can encourage transformation and promote consciousness. Games like Life is Strange allow players to navigate intricate moral choices, making them consider on the outcomes of their actions. The game’s concentration on topics such as friendship, mental health, and time travel stimulates players to think thoughtfully about their actual actions and interactions. This affective involvement enables gamers to become more compassionate and conscious of the world around them.
A further significant illustration is The War of Mine, which puts players in the role of civilians attempting to persist in a war-torn setting. The game forces gamers to confront difficult choices that affect the lives of figures within the narrative, cultivating a significant understanding of the horrors of war. By highlighting the individual cost of warfare, This War of Mine urges players to consider critically about world issues and the plight of those affected by aggression and hardship.
The game Undertale creatively navigates concepts of mercy, forgiveness, and the consequences of aggression. With its original combat mechanics that permits for peaceful approaches, players are inspired to settle disputes through compassion rather than combat. This not only changes the playing experience but also communicates a wider lesson about the value of kindness and understanding in real life. Each choice gamers make can significantly change the result of the game, emphasizing the notion that every action, no matter how small, can have a lasting impact.
Interactive Educational Experiences
Educational games have gained popularity as powerful tools for education while having fun. One standout game is Minecraft for Education, which enables players to build and discover digital worlds while studying subjects like numeracy, history, and STEM. The game cultivates imagination and cooperation, allowing players to join forces on tasks and develop problem-solving skills. Its exciting environment keeps players driven and eager.
Another notable name is Kahoot!, a interactive learning platform that lets users to make and take part in quizzes on various topics. With its lively interface and challenging elements, Kahoot changes traditional learning into an exciting experience. Instructors and pupils alike can take advantage of this platform for classroom activities, reinforcing knowledge through gameplay and encouraging playful competition among friends.
Duolingo offers a unique spin on language learning through playing games. Users can learn languages through a series of enjoyable and interesting mini-games that push their lexicon, language structure, and speaking skills. The app’s rewarding system motivates learners to keep advancing, making language acquisition fun. With its attention on social interaction, the app helps create a community spirit among students of language.
